Problem:
Fellwell is a company producing ?ight safety parachutes for drones. The cost of producing a parachute can be breakdown into ?xed cost of $50000 per year and variable cost of $200 per parachute.
(a) Explain how gross pro?t from selling parachute can be computed.
(b) If the company sold the parachute harness at $300 per harness, what is the minimum sales quantity per month for the company to break even?
(c) If the company decides to sell the harness at $450 per harness, what is the minimum sales quantity per month to break even?
(d) What are the factors that affect whether the company could price its parachute harness at $450 instead of $300?
